Urban Rooftop Elopement | Phoenix, AZ

An urban elopement in the neighborhood where they first met—

I truly could not have envisioned a more full circle setting for Haley and Ken’s downtown Phoenix wedding day. These two met while attending ASU and spent the early years of their friendship turned relationship wandering the up and coming streets of downtown Phoenix. Though their careers have taken them away from the Valley now, it always seemed like the perfect place to get married. After the two decided to scrap their traditional wedding plans (and the stress and drama that can so very easily accompany those plans), they opted for a winter wedding in the desert, focusing in on the very neighborhood where their love started.

And that’s how we all ended up on the rooftop of the Renaissance in the middle of downtown on a gorgeous, sunny December afternoon. I’m so happy Haley and Ken opted for the much less stressful route in wedding planning, simply finding a space to hold their ceremony, gather their closest friends and family, and then head off to dinner to celebrate after. They chose to include me in the midst of the moments they wanted photographed, which began with Haley’s dad walking her down to the street for her first look with Ken. To celebrate the very place in which they met and were getting married, they chose to see each other for the first time in front of one of downtown Phoenix’s very colorful murals.

After taking in this sweet moment together, we headed back to the hotel (I will forever be a big fan of the candid photos that come with navigating urban settings in wedding clothes), where hundreds of young dancers were staying for a competition. It was so sweet watching hundreds of little girls fawning over the real life princess that was Haley in her wedding dress, all done up and beautiful! These made for some very fun and unique little shots throughout the day. We even caught some of the curious kids watching their ceremony through the hotel’s windows 🥲🥲🥲🥲🥲.

Hand in hand, Haley and Ken made their way up to the rooftop where their closest people waited for them to arrive for their ceremony. After exchanging personal vows, so many hugs, and toasting to forever together, Haley and Ken were officially married! We had one last stop on the agenda for the afternoon. As the sun set, we headed over to the very pub where Haley and Ken spent so many of their early years for some whiskey. It only seemed fitting this be the very first thing they do as a now married couple, to complete their full circle day.
